How Many Days Is Eid al-Adha?

Religiously, Eid al-Adha lasts for four days.

During these four days Muslims:

  • Perform Eid prayer
  • Offer Qurbani
  • Visit relatives
  • Exchange Eid greetings
  • Share food and charity

These days are considered spiritually special and meaningful.

Is the Day of Arafah Included?

The Day of Arafah is the day before Eid al-Adha.

Although it is not officially part of Eid:

  • It holds great spiritual value
  • Many Muslims prepare for Eid
  • Dua and worship increase
  • Tashreeq Takbeer begins

Many people consider it the spiritual beginning of Eid celebrations.

How Long Can Qurbani Be Performed?

Qurbani:

  • Begins after Eid prayer on the first day
  • Usually continues until sunset on the third day

Some Islamic opinions also allow sacrifice on the fourth day.

How Long Is the Public Holiday?

Public holiday durations vary by country.

In many Muslim countries:

  • The Day of Arafah may be a partial holiday
  • The four Eid days are official holidays

Holiday periods may become longer when combined with weekends.

Recommended Acts During Eid

Muslims are encouraged to:

  • Take a ghusl bath
  • Wear clean clothes
  • Attend Eid prayer
  • Recite Tashreeq Takbeer
  • Help people in need
  • Reconcile with others

These actions beautify the spirit of Eid.
